In Bohuslav, Trinity Church believers reaffirm loyalty to UOC

On July 17, 2022, in the city of Bohuslav of the Kyiv region (the Bila Tserkva Eparchy), supporters of the OCU held a meeting about the transfer of the Trinity Church community (UOC) to the Dumenko structure, reports the Kamyanets-Podilskyi City Council deputy's assistant and human rights activist Victoria Kokhanovska on her Facebook page.

Supporters of the OCU gathered at the local House of Culture. They already had lists with affirmative votes. "We were collecting signatures on Wednesday, Thursday and Friday," explained one of the organizers of the gathering, while being asked, "Which Church are you collecting signatures for?" she replied, "UOC-KP." All those who wanted to enter the institution had their passports checked by people in military uniform and were required to register locally.

At this "veche" (gathering – Trans.) in the House of Culture, the territorial community voted for the transfer of the Trinity Church of the UOC to the OCU. Several activists went to the temple to demand the keys, but the UOC believers who had gathered on the temple grounds refused to give them.

At the same time, one of the OCU activists said that the schismatics have all the rights to the Holy Trinity Church. "We legally have everything we need to come in here. But we will let the situation go because we have peace of mind and we are not bloodthirsty. Everything has to be according to the law. So I propose that we disperse. We will decide how we will proceed. The law is on our side and we will transfer this church to the jurisdiction of the OCU," the Dumenko supporter promised.

Parishioners of the Trinity Church reaffirmed that they remain in the UOC. "They say it is written in the Gospel that when you are slapped on one cheek, turn the other. We have already turned the other cheek, we do not have a third. We have to defend ourselves – legally, prayerfully, with love in our hearts, with respect," stressed one of the priests of the Trinity Church.

Lawyer Viktoria Kokhanovska said that the church in Bohuslav has been defended as the meetings of the territorial community have no legal force.

As reported, the OCU is preparing to seize a UOC church in the village of Korobchino.
